Runbook: Grindle ORM refactor. Legacy mappers in /old_orm are frozen — do not extend. New models go through the Relay layer. Dual-write is active until the migration flag flips; removing it early corrupts joins. Rollback means reverting the flag, never the schema. Keep shims annotated with removal tickets. The migration status and remaining table inventory live on the tracking page.

runbook for badug-kadup: https://confluence.zemvarlabs.internal/projects/browse/display/projects/bd1b

Building Access — Holiday Opening Hours (Thornquay House)

Heads up, contractors: Thornquay House runs reduced hours over the holidays. From 23 December to 3 January, the building opens at 08:00 and locks up at 16:00 sharp — no exceptions, the heating goes off too. Weekend access is off the table entirely. If you're finishing the atrium works, plan deliveries for mornings only, as the goods lift is shared with the caterers. The side entrance on Lantern Row stays usable for contractors, and it takes the seasonal pass code below.

staff pass of kawip-hawef = bdg-QLP-2

- [ ] **Step 7: Breaker override escrow.** After sealing the signing keys for the Tallgrove upstream API circuit breaker, confirm the support team can force the breaker open during a full outage. The override bundle lives in the sealed escrow drawer and is useless without its unlock phrase. Two ceremony witnesses must initial this step before proceeding. The escrow bundle is decrypted with the recovery passphrase that follows.

vault phrase of kahip-kahop = holath-quenmir